em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

master fa37deba2e: ; Explicitly declare linum-mode obsolete


From: Stefan Kangas
Subject: master fa37deba2e: ; Explicitly declare linum-mode obsolete
Date: Wed, 21 Sep 2022 08:23:00 -0400 (EDT)

branch: master
commit fa37deba2eaca900fa3da6624c287ddec1fa61c4
Author: Stefan Kangas <stefankangas@gmail.com>
Commit: Stefan Kangas <stefankangas@gmail.com>

    ; Explicitly declare linum-mode obsolete
    
    * lisp/obsolete/linum.el (linum-mode, global-linum-mode):
    Explicitly declare obsolete to warn the user, and recommend using
    'display-line-numbers-mode' instead.
    Suggested by Philip Kaludercic <philipk@posteo.net>.
---
 lisp/obsolete/linum.el | 3 +++
 1 file changed, 3 insertions(+)

diff --git a/lisp/obsolete/linum.el b/lisp/obsolete/linum.el
index 017c06e426..c6ce3d6d11 100644
--- a/lisp/obsolete/linum.el
+++ b/lisp/obsolete/linum.el
@@ -248,6 +248,9 @@ Linum mode is a buffer-local minor mode."
 (defconst linum-version "0.9x")
 (make-obsolete-variable 'linum-version 'emacs-version "28.1")
 
+(make-obsolete 'linum-mode #'display-line-numbers-mode "29.1")
+(make-obsolete 'global-linum-mode #'global-display-line-numbers-mode "29.1")
+
 (provide 'linum)
 
 ;;; linum.el ends here



reply via email to

[Prev in Thread] Current Thread [Next in Thread]